Harmony School of Innovation-Sugar Land college-going snapshot
In 2024, 117 of 153 trackable graduates were found in covered Texas enrollment records, a 76.5% tracked enrollment rate. 6 graduates had a separately reported UT Austin enrollment row (3.2% of all graduates). These are enrollment outcomes, not acceptance rates.
College-going trend
Graduates found in Texas higher-education records
| Class year | Graduates | Trackable graduates | Enrolled | Tracked enrollment rate | Not found |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2019 | 172 | 152 | 124 | 81.6% | 28 |
| 2020 | 154 | 133 | 99 | 74.4% | 34 |
| 2021 | 150 | 130 | 101 | 77.7% | 29 |
| 2022 | 155 | 139 | 104 | 74.8% | 35 |
| 2023 | 161 | 141 | 108 | 76.6% | 33 |
| 2024 | 188 | 153 | 117 | 76.5% | 36 |

2024 destinations
Complete published college destination list
All 8 destination rows retained from the campus file are shown below. Named institutions keep their six-digit FICE code; Other rows combine institutions suppressed by THECB at the school level.
| Destination | FICE code | Students | Share of graduates |
|---|---|---|---|
| University of Houston | 003652 | 47 | 25.0% |
| Other Public 4-year Institutions12 institutions combined | — | 19 | 10.1% |
| Houston City College | 010633 | 18 | 9.6% |
| Texas A&M University | 003632 | 10 | 5.3% |
| Wharton County Junior College | 003668 | 8 | 4.3% |
| U. of Houston-Downtown | 012826 | 6 | 3.2% |
| University of Texas at Austin | 003658 | 6 | 3.2% |
| Other Public 2-year Institutions2 institutions combined | — | 3 | 1.6% |

First-year performance
GPA bands by public college sector
| College sector | Below 2.0 | 2.0–2.49 | 2.5–2.99 | 3.0–3.49 | Above 3.5 | Unknown |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| Public four-year | 10 | 4 | 14 | 24 | 29 | 0 |
| Public two-year | 9 | 7 | 5 | 11 | 8 | 0 |
GPA counts cover graduates attending Texas public institutions. THECB suppresses GPA detail when fewer than five students attend a public sector.
Methodology and caveats
- Enrollment source: Texas Higher Education Coordinating Board campus files.
- GPA source: Texas Higher Education Coordinating Board first-year GPA files.
- Tracked enrollment rate equals enrolled graduates divided by graduates excluding records THECB classifies as not trackable.
- Not found does not necessarily mean a graduate did not attend college; it means the graduate was not located in the records covered by this Texas report.
